What is Next.js overflow show component?
Next.js overflow show is a feature that handles overflow content display, ensuring a seamless user experience and maintaining responsive design through CSS properties. This component ensures that content overflows are correctly handled to prevent layout issues on different mobile devices. By applying style properties like overflow: auto, developers can manage how overflow content behaves without affecting the application performance. Furthermore, you can import image file and use static files for optimization, ensuring that images are rendered smoothly on both server side rendering and client side. The lazy loading of images can be incorporated to improve efficiency on pages with large image data. To ensure avoid layout shift, programmers should consider min width, max width, and padding to accommodate scrollbars in different screen sizes, including pixels. As part of good practice, always set the placeholder prop when working with image components. This helps in optimizing image visibility and efficiency while maintaining the visual integrity of the page during render. Background images should be utilized effectively with blur or pattern strategies to build dynamic layouts, especially in the case of overlay elements. These techniques enhance visual appeal and create depth while ensuring content remains legible.
How to use Next.js overflow shows?
Next.js overflow shows are useful when you want to control how content behaves when it exceeds the boundaries of its container, especially in responsive layouts or dynamic content areas. Using overflow properties helps prevent layout breakage by managing scrollbars or hiding excess content, improving user experience and visual consistency. This is important for building clean, user-friendly interfaces that handle varied content sizes gracefully.
To use Next.js overflow shows, first create a new Next.js project. Inside your component, apply styles to manage overflow, such as overflow: hidden or overflow: auto. Utilize the built-in layout features to structure your design, ensuring scroll functionality works seamlessly across various screen sizes. If an error occurs, check the console for any missing dependencies or incorrect imports of static files. Programmers can adjust the y scroll or x-scroll based on the content's dimensions and width requirements. To implement responsive designs, utilize media queries to adapt the container size for different browsers. When designing, consider using relative and absolute positioning for elements like div containers to avoid overflow from causing issues in layouts.
If needed, you can also utilize scripts and dependencies to handle dynamic resizing and ensure proper alignment of elements. Consider using existing open source packages and API calls to manage dynamic data and content rendering. In the context of web development, JavaScript is crucial for handling request and ensuring the usage of APIs. For example, when an object is invoked, it is important to ensure that the correct version of the element is loaded, whether it's a PNG or JPEG file. Programmers can encounter issues when certain elements are blocked due to improper positioning, causing a difference in layout. To resolve this, programmers can use const to define the image's position and size, ensuring that the full width is applied when needed. Array handling is essential for dynamic content updates and ensuring space is appropriately allocated on the page. Make sure your layout is fixed for a stable experience, with properly defined dependencies in the package file, ensuring smooth operation and security.
How to style Next.js overflow shows?
Styling overflow behavior in Next.js components enhances the user interface by controlling how content that exceeds container boundaries is displayed. Proper overflow styling ensures that layouts remain clean and visually appealing, preventing unwanted scrollbars or hidden content issues. This contributes to a better user experience by maintaining readability and smooth interaction across different screen sizes and devices.
To style Next.js overflow, use styling attributes like overflow, overflow-x, and overflow-y to manage content visibility. Utilize styled-components or modules for scoped styles. Consider media queries for responsive designs and ensure proper box-sizing with box-sizing: border-box for better layout control. To optimize efficiency, programmers should ensure that content is loaded efficiently, using loading techniques to reduce the initial load time. Also, avoid unnecessary scripts that may block the image rendering process. The scrollbar should be visible based on content overflow, allowing users to interact with the interface seamlessly. Ensure resize is handled properly when the window size changes. Lastly, programmers can take advantage of the default behavior for y-scroll if scrolling is needed to navigate through tabular data or lists. Performance can be further enhanced by utilizing cache and security features in the browser to store static files efficiently.
How to build Next.js overflow shows using Purecode AI?
Building Next.js overflow shows using Purecode AI is important because it streamlines the development process by automatically generating optimized, reusable components that handle content overflow gracefully. This approach reduces manual coding errors and saves significant time, enabling developers to focus on enhancing user experience rather than wrestling with layout issues. Additionally, Purecode AI ensures consistent styling and responsiveness across different viewports, which is crucial for maintaining a polished and professional app interface.
To build a Next.js overflow show component using PureCode AI, follow these simple steps: Visit the PureCode AI website and enter your project requirements. Select Nextjs as your framework. Customize your design by choosing suitable themes. Browse available variants, select your preference, and click 'Code' to generate the Nextjs script. A function script for managing overflow will be generated for you, allowing seamless presentation of content within the boundaries of your design. Afterward, you can make any necessary edits and include image files as required. Once satisfied, simply copy and paste the generated script into your project to enhance your workflow and improve efficiency. A note should be made that the rest of the content is properly aligned, and for better efficiency, the support of caching techniques is essential. In such cases, the URL and other external resources should be managed properly. Log data when issues arise, and be cautious of false entries that might interfere with the page load. It is desirable to respond efficiently to user actions to avoid unnecessary blocking of elements, such as images or scripts. The split approach is vital when handling large volumes of data, ensuring that each action is executed correctly and that the value of the data being processed doesn’t negatively impact efficiency. This helps in preventing efficiency issues while maintaining smooth page interactions.